WebbShort-term memory loss is very common after a brain injury – thankfully there are plenty of coping strategies available. Typical situations include forgetting people's names, losing a train of thought, getting lost at the shops, repeating or forgetting past conversations, misplacing objects and difficulty learning new skills. Webb28 nov. 2024 · Feelings of sadness, frustration and loss are common after brain injury. These feelings often appear during the later stages of recovery, after the individual has become more aware of the long-term situation. If these feelings become overwhelming or interfere with recovery, the person may be suffering from depression. After about six months, I was able to start driving and walking long distances again, but I was still terrified of raising my heart rate. scattergories wheelWebbElder abuse-related injuries are often missed as they may be thought to be related to the aging process or a disease. A fracture may be attributed to osteoporosis rather than a shove. Bruising might be attributed to blood thinning medicines commonly taken by older adults rather than a slap or punch.
